Mustang Print: Your Companion in Higher-High quality Printing Answers
When looking at delivering major-notch printing expert services, Mustang Print stands staying a trusted identify on the market. Situated in Australia, this provider has produced alone as getting a chief in delivering an array of printing methods that cater to equally person and small business requirements. No matter if you are looking for vivid bus